Abstract
⺠Quantitative synthesis of motor-related neural activity after stroke. ⺠Contralesional M1 and bilateral PMC activity differentiates patients and controls. ⺠Recruitment of original activation sites indicates better clinical outcome. ⺠No consistent relationship between contralesional M1 activity and clinical deficit.
